CMD INVESTS £1/4 MILLION IN NEW MACHINE AS PART OF FACTORY UPGRADE

We have invested in a new £1/4m TRUMPF CNC metal punch as part of an asset renewal strategy for our UK manufacturing capability. The new machine will be used in the production of a wide variety of our power distribution systems and workstation power products at our Rotherham factory. Understanding Lithium Battery Inverters and Their Benefits

Lithium battery inverters have gained popularity due to their efficiency and versatility. These devices convert DC power from lithium batteries into AC power for home or industrial use. A recent industry report indicates that the global lithium-ion battery market is projected to reach $100 billion by 2025, reflecting the growing reliance on sustainable energy solutions. Battery inverters play a critical role in this transformation by enabling renewable energy systems to function effectively.

One significant advantage of lithium battery inverters is their high cycle life. Research shows that lithium batteries can maintain up to 80% capacity after 2,000 cycles. This longevity reduces the frequency of battery replacements compared to lead-acid options, ultimately lowering long-term costs. Furthermore, lithium technology allows for faster charging times, catering to the demands of modern energy consumption.

Key Features to Look for in Lithium Battery Inverters

When choosing a lithium battery inverter, consider the power capacity it offers. Look for an inverter that meets your energy needs. Typical options range from 1000W to 5000W. This range helps accommodate various appliances. Assess the efficiency rating, as higher efficiency ensures less energy loss. Aim for inverters above 90% efficiency for better performance.

Another key feature is the inverter's compatibility with different battery systems. Many units support various lithium battery types. This flexibility allows users to find the best fit for their energy storage. Safety is also paramount. Features like over-voltage protection and temperature control can prevent hazardous situations. These details significantly enhance reliability over time.

Keep in mind that size and weight can impact installation. Compact models may suit small spaces but could have limitations. Ensure adequate ventilation to prolong the inverter's lifespan.
